[zircon] [gn] Build the vDSO

This includes building and running abigen to generate headers
and sources.  It also includes the first support for compiling
for Fuchsia user code, and for linking shared libraries.

What is Fuchsia?

Fuchsia is a modular, capability-based operating system. Fuchsia runs on modern 64-bit Intel and ARM processors.

Fuchsia is an open source project with a code of conduct that we expect everyone who interacts with the project to respect.
